Business
Enherent Corp. (ENHT) operates as an information technology services company focused on providing consultative resource and staffing solutions in the northeastern United States. The company offers IT staffing and consulting services encompassing project management, business analysis, systems and database architecture, application development, network engineering, and quality assurance and testing; its application development services include planning, design, code development, testing, and deployment of custom applications or enhancements to existing systems, as well as evaluation and implementation of third-party business application software to improve operational efficiency. Enherent serves industries such as insurance, financial services, banking and capital markets, retail distribution, apparel, health care, pharmaceutical, and consumer goods. Founded in 1989 and headquartered in Syosset, New York, the company maintains operations primarily along the East Coast, including New York, New Jersey, Connecticut, and Washington, D.C.
